Reduces condensation

Condensation happens naturally when water vapour cools and becomes liquid. This can happen on furniture, windows, and other surfaces of your home. Condensation can be caused by a variety of elements, such as humidity levels and inadequate ventilation. However, a double glazed window can help reduce condensation in your home by providing an additional layer of insulation, and also reduce the temperature fluctuations within your home.

If you notice condensation on your windows then it's time for you to replace the windows. This is particularly the case if you notice cracks, holes, or scratches on the glass. Cracks and holes can be an indication that the sealant between glass panes has worn away, which can reduce the efficiency of your double glazing.

If you notice that your windows are starting to look cloudy It's crucial to act immediately. This could affect the appearance of your home and reduce your view of the outside. It's also a sign that your windows are no longer as energy efficient as they should be.

There are several methods to fix a misty window, such as the use of a dehumidifier as well as opening the windows for a short period of time each day. You can also employ a special dry agent that is placed in the space between the window panes.
